# manage zfs services class zfs::service { if $zfs::service_manage { exec { 'modprobe zfs': path => $facts['path'], unless => 'grep -q "^zfs " /proc/modules', } case $facts['service_provider'] { 'systemd': { $cache_ensure = str2bool($facts['zfs_zpool_cache_present']) ? { true => 'running', default => 'stopped', } $scan_ensure = str2bool($facts['zfs_zpool_cache_present']) ? { true => 'stopped', default => 'running', } service { 'zfs-import-cache': ensure => $cache_ensure, enable => true, hasstatus => true, hasrestart => true, require => Exec['modprobe zfs'], before => Service['zfs-mount'], } service { 'zfs-import-scan': ensure => $scan_ensure, enable => true, hasstatus => true, hasrestart => true, require => Exec['modprobe zfs'], before => Service['zfs-mount'], } } default: { case $facts['os']['family'] { 'RedHat': { service { 'zfs-import': ensure => running, enable => true, hasstatus => true, hasrestart => true, require => Exec['modprobe zfs'], before => Service['zfs-mount'], } } 'Debian': { $import_ensure = str2bool($facts['zfs_zpool_cache_present']) ? { true => 'running', default => 'stopped', } service { 'zpool-import': ensure => $import_ensure, enable => true, hasstatus => true, hasrestart => true, require => Exec['modprobe zfs'], } } default: { # noop } } } } service { 'zfs-mount': ensure => running, enable => true, hasstatus => true, hasrestart => true, before => Service['zfs-share'], } service { 'zfs-share': ensure => running, enable => true, hasstatus => true, hasrestart => true, } } }
